Ukraine to mark Holocaust Day
Parliament in Kiev decides to turn International Holocaust Remembrance Day
on January 27 into country's official commemoration day. Ukraine to mark
70th anniversary of Babi Yar massacre this year with series of special
events

By a large majority, the Ukrainian parliament has decided to turn
International Holocaust Remembrance Day into an official commemoration day
in the country, the Interfax news agency reported Tuesday.
 
The world marks International Holocaust Remembrance Day on January 27,
the anniversary of the liberation of the Auschwitz-Birkenau death camp.

The parliament also decided to mark the 70th anniversary of the Babi Yar
massacre this year with a series of special events.
 
The decision of the Verkhovna Rada (Ukraine's parliament) was unequivocal,
with 331 of 450 representatives voting in favor of commemorating the Jews
murdered in the Holocaust in an annual state memorial day, and marking the
70th anniversary of the massacre in the ravine west of Kiev with special
events.
